This chapter explores the four dimensions of the menstrual health gap: access to period products, education, sanitation, and the impact of taboos and stigmas. It highlights the significant economic consequences of this gap and the lack of knowledge surrounding menstruation.
  • Lack of access to affordable and safe period care products is a fundamental barrier.
  • Only 55% of respondents in a global survey claimed knowledge about menstruation.
  • 367 million children globally lack sanitation services in their schools.

To truly close the gender gap, we’ll need to address the menstrual health gap. A lack of access to hygiene care, solutions, education and more holds back those who menstruate at school and work, leading to real knock-on effects to the economy. Sahil Tesfu, the Chief Strategy Officer for health and hygiene company Essity Group, breaks down how age-old taboos related to women’s health have led to big barriers for social progress overall and the simple changes that leaders in business can boost everything from workplace health and psychological safety to productivity.
